✔✔Inspection Documentation Top 3 Questions - ✔✔As you document each defect on
the checklist, evaluate it against the criteria in MIL-STD-3037 to answer the following
questions:


1. Which reference paragraph or figure is applicable to determine defect acceptability?
2. Is the defect minor or major?
3. Does the defect exceed IMDG and/or Non-IMDG defect criteria?

✔✔ International shipping of goods prior to containerization was known as __________.
- ✔✔Break-bulk

✔✔Break-bulk method of transport - ✔✔Increased handling of goods in port

✔✔Containerization method of transportation - ✔✔Increased shipping speed, reduced
shipping costs, and reduced port congestion

✔✔CSC - ✔✔Convention for Safe Containers (1972), an international agreement
maintaining global container handling and transportation standards. It requires structural
safety approval of all internationally-transported ISO containers. It also mandates
periodic inspections at specified intervals to ensure safe condition. In the United States,
49 CFR Parts 450 to 453 and Public Law 95-208 mandate compliance with CSC
standards.

✔✔ISO - ✔✔International Standards Organization, an international association
responsible for developing global standards and specifications for products, services
and practices

, ✔✔ISO Container - ✔✔A standardized international shipping container designed to
make global material transport safer and more efficient (also called freight container,
shipping container, hi-cube container, Conex, or sea can)

✔✔Intermodal - ✔✔Standardized shipping container that can be moved from one mode
of transport to another (ship, rail, or truck) without unloading and reloading the contents

✔✔International Safe Container Act - ✔✔The International Safe Container Act became
public law in the United States in 1977. The Code of Federal Regulations, Title 49 (49
CFR) directs all foreign and domestic shipments to comply with CSC standards.

✔✔46 US Code (USC) - ✔✔United States Code (USC) Title 46, Appendix - Shipping,
Chapter 34, Safe Containers for International Cargo, gives the Secretary of
Transportation the authority to administer the International Safe Container Act. It
establishes penalties—fines of up to $5,000 per day—for non-compliance.

✔✔49 CFR - ✔✔49 CFR is the implementation arm of 46 USC, broken into numerous
sections by subject/purpose.

Parts 450-453 of 49 CFR, SUBCHAPTER B, Safety Approval of Cargo Containers,
apply to the use of containers in international traffic:
##Part 450 establishes container marking requirements.
##Part 451 establishes safety approval plate specifications.
##Part 452 establishes container examination requirements.
##Part 453 outlines control and enforcement.

✔✔DoD Pub DTR 4500.9-R - ✔✔Defense Transportation Regulation (DTR) 4500.9-R,
Part VI imposes international and federal CSC requirements on containers
(commercially-owned or military) transporting DoD material anywhere in the world.



Chapter 604 of this regulation identifies CSC container inspector certification
requirements.

✔✔MIL-STD-3037 - ✔✔Military Standard (MIL-STD) 3037 provides inspection
standards for containers transporting DoD material. It is used by civilian and military
container inspectors to ensure compliance with international and federal inspection and
documentation requirements.



MIL-STD-3037 is the primary reference used by inspectors to conduct CSC container
inspections.
